Pros

The company respects employees, and offers great benefits, including profit sharing and reduced cost stock purchase plans. Working from home is allowed, and encouraged, within reason. Getting the job done is the focus. You can rise as far as you are qualified to rise, and experience is valued.

Cons

Sometimes layoffs happen that might have been avoided...

Pros

Healthy diversity is supported at TI. There is no bias based on religion, race, sexual orientation, nationality, etc. TI's comprehensive diversity network allows employees to participate in many different employee-run diversity groups. TI as a whole seems to stand behind good values and treats their employees well.

Cons

Opportunities for promotion seem limited based on management and tech ladder structures. I get the sense that promotions and raises move slower than other companies.
